Mowalola opens pop-up store in London's Shoreditch

As pop-up stores go, this is one of the briefest but brightest. For two days (26-28 November) emerging designer Mowalola Ogunlesi hosts her first (albeit temporary) store at the Dray Walk Gallery in Shoreditch, London.


Mowalola Ogunlesi


The Central Saint Martins graduate, Fashion East alumni and creative director for Kanye West’s Yeezy Gap offer, is presenting her ‘Lola Land’ merchandise drop and archival pieces, alongside a three-colourways limited-edition ‘Monsta’ boot and the brand’s signature ‘Bundle’ bags.

In addition, the pop-up will offer exclusive merchandise ranging from a ‘Jesus 4 Life’ hoodie to ‘Free Mowa’ T-shirts, ‘Tramp Stamp’ transferrable tattoos and a complementing hoodie with the same tribal ‘M’ design logo rings.

The space will be also host unique furniture items, including a table made in collaboration with Chapel.

The physical store opening reflects her growing position as an increasingly influential London-based designer. Her first show at London Fashion Week in 2019 attracted the attention of artists and designers including Drake, Solanage, Kim Jones and Skepta.

The designer has since worked with Nike to design the Nigerian football team's kit, collaborating with Skepta on his ‘Pure Water’ music video and was one of six designers picked by British Vogue to dress the 60th anniversary Barbie.
